Our Queer Maritimes
Nova Scotia, New Brunswick, and PEI have rich queer communities and culture full of interesting people. Our Queer Maritimes aims to spotlight those people, communities, and events. Queer Maritimers, past and present, deserve to be celebrated and understood. Hosted by Alex JJ Harris. Music is by Ryley Boutilier from Asto Studios. Colin North and Shoghi Taha are our story editors.

Gab Rogers: Running a high school GSA 24.02.2026 8:00
Gab Rogers is a queer teacher in New Brunswick. For six years, she ran a high school GSA. Alex was in that GSA for four of those years. What does it take to run a Gender and Sexuality Alliance? What does the group look like? Last summer, Alex sat down with her to talk about that experience.

Emily Seymour - Photography and Creativity in Halifax 13.01.2026 10:42
Emily Seymour is a photographer based in Halifax. She focuses on documenting Burlesque and Drag performances. What does life look like as a queer artist? How does Emily keep community at the center of her work? Alex dives into all of this and more. What is the show about?
